Tris(1,10-phenanthroline)copper(II) di-μ-iodo-bis(diiodomercurate) dimethyl sulfoxide monohydrate

Abstract: In the cationic complex present in the title compound, [Cu(C12H8N2)3][Hg2I6].C2H6OS.H2O, the copper(II) center adopts a highly distorted octahedral geometry, ligated by the six N atoms of three 1,10-phenanthroline ligands. The structure includes an iodide-bridged dimeric mercurate anion for neutrality and uncoordinated dimethyl sulfoxide and water molecules.

“…The equatorial coordination bonds reveal values slightly above 2 Å, contrary to much longer Cu−N bonds in the axial positions. The six-coordinative axially elongated [Cu(phen) 3 ] 2+ countercation is not very common in coordination chemistry; however, it is known to form stable ionic architectures together with simple anions such as ClO 4 − , PF 6 − , SO 4 2− , C(CN) 3 − , or F 3 CSO 3 − as well as with the complex anions of Hg 2 I 6 2− , [Co(C 2 H 11 B 9 ) 2 ] − (3,3′-commo-bis(1,2-dicarba-3-cobalt(III)-closo-dodecarborate), or N-2-(phenyl)ethyliminodiacetato−copper coordination systems.…”
